Program areas at Sojourner House / Webosset Hill Station
Housing programs - Sojourner House provides assistance to individuals and families to help them find and secure housing through transitional housing programs, rapid rehousing programs, and permanent supportive housing programs. Clients are assisted in locating an apartment and receive rental assistance and supportive services throughout their time in the program. In fiscal year 2022, we provided 48,512 bed nights in rapid rehousing to 234 clients and 22,946 bed nights in permanent supportive housing to 72 clients, as well as 15,806 bed nights in transitional housing to 74 clients. The short-term rental assistance program helps clients pay past rent, security deposits, and utility bills. In fiscal year 2022, we helped 15 clients for a total of $32,690 in short-term rental assistance. We also provided 1,249 bed nights in crisis housing for 17 clients.
Trafficking: Sojourner House provides emergency shelter, transitional housing, basic needs, clinical counseling, and related supportive services to victims of human trafficking. In fy 2022, the theia emergency shelter served a total of 30 clients for a total of 2,031nights. We also served 8 clients in 6 units for a total of 2,334 bed nights in the trafficking transitional housing program.
Drop in/community service/education: Sojourner House operates a drop-in center advocacy and resource center in the city of providence. Clients can access emotional support, support groups, clinical therapy, hiv testing, immigration advocacy, and other related programs. During our 2022 fiscal year, we provided a total of 9,199 sessions across our community programs for a total of 4,009 hours. Over 175 clients received clinical services for 1,619 sessions and 1,391 hours. 222 total hiv tests were administered, 194 hep-c tests were administered and 1,050 people were outreached through hiv education and outreach efforts. A total of 122 clients attended 198 support groups for 272 hours. Additionally, 285 clients received legal immigration advocacy for 1,597 sessions for 1,257 hours.finally, Sojourner House envisions a world free of domestic violence, sexual assault, and human trafficking. Therefore we provide a wide array of educational trainings, workshops, and programming to youth of all ages. During the fy 2022 fiscal year, Sojourner House provided 324 total school-based sessions and reached 6,262 participants; and 55 community education sessions that reached 744 participants.
Emergency and shelter interventions - Sojourner House provides immediate, emergency interventions to victims of domestic violence, sexual assault, and human trafficking. We provide three emergency shelters, including a specific shelter for victims of human trafficking and a residential program tailored for the lgbtq+ community. During the fy 2022 year, we provided 8,831 bed nights to 110 clients. Over 1,471 hotline calls were answered and over 4,242 referrals were made to other agencies.
